Desdemona and the Deep, C.S.E. Cooney. This was a lot of fun - rich heiress realizes her father has traded away some of his workers to the fae, and goes down to the fae underworld to get them back. Well-written, compelling pacing, some good imagery, an f/f relationship and a trans character, good stuff all around. Will probably add it to my nominations (I believe the theory is that at 41017 words it can get administrated into the novella category for Hugo purposes).
